    Abstract: Shape memory tissue engagement elements (15) are created using shape memory alloys or shape memory (SM) composite sheets (33, 36) with one or more SM material sheets (20, 32). Arrays of the tissue engagement elements may then be inserted or molded into flexible base materials forming pads for tissue engagement. In certain embodiments, the composite sheets incorporate two SM material layers (20, 32) having differing transition temperatures to allow activation of one layer for tissue engagement and activation of the second layer for tissue release. In exemplary embodiments, insertion of interconnected tissue engagement elements (46) into a base layer (19) with slots (48) provides a completed pad array. In alternative exemplary embodiments, vacuum forming of composite sheets (51) with cutting of corrugated sides (53) to form tissue engagement elements allow production of complete arrays of tissue engagement elements. Overmolding the arrays with a flexible base material (19) provides a completed pad.

    Abstract: A material engagement element sheet formed from a sheet material (10) incorporates a pattern of material engagement element slots (14), each slot containing an array of material engagement elements (20) which have a tapered distal section (30), a flange section (34) and a proximal section (32) which is attached to an edge of the slots in the sheet material. The material engagement element sheet material may be a single layer of shape memory material, or the sheet material may be a composite of different layers some of which may include pre-strained shape memory materials with distinguishable activation parameters. The material engagement element slot configuration allows for the simultaneous processing of the material engagement elements. The material engagement elements may be processed such that they are in a state that is substantially perpendicular to the surface of the material engagement element sheet.
